HISTORY

The fishing shed on the Hastings jetty was built in 1866. It played an important part in the local fishing industry. It was restored in 1988 and became a retail fish sales outlet.

DESCRIPTION

This image shows three men leaning on a railing beside a small shed. They are all smiling for the camera. The man on the right has his left hand on the top of his hat. The board on the front of the shed reads: “Circa 1866 Hastings Jetty Fish Shed Restoration 1989”. Part of a jetty, water and tanks can be seen in the background. The following is printed on the right-hand side of the photograph: “Hastings Jetty Fish Shed Restoration Project Financed by Bill Patience The Third. Work undertaken by Bill Patience John Doug Norton’.
